摘要

Ob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) is a common disorder in children but can occasionally present with life-threatening hypoxemia. Obesity is a significant risk factor for poor outcomes of OSA treatment. Continuous positive airway pressure (CPAP) is indicated in children who are not candidates for or have an unsatisfactory response to adenotonsillectomy. Children acutely at risk for significant morbidity with other therapies are candidates for a tracheostomy. An eight-year-old patient with morbid obesity and severe OSA refractory to CPAP therapy was treated successfully with a novel noninvasive ventilation (NIV) mode with volume-assured pressure support (VAPS) and avoided tracheostomy.
机译:阻塞性睡眠呼吸暂停(OSA)是儿童的常见疾病,但偶尔会出现危及生命的低氧血症。肥胖是OSA治疗效果差的重要危险因素。对于不适合或不满意腺扁桃体切除术的儿童,应表明持续的气道正压通气(CPAP)。患有严重其他疾病的高危患儿可进行气管切开术。一名8岁的病态肥胖和严重OSA对CPAP难治的患者成功接受了新型无创通气(NIV)模式和容积保证压力支持(VAPS)治疗,并避免了气管切开术。
